Q: Does the Soundmere waveform preview process raw audio on the client?

A: No. The Quillstack renderer generates waveform previews server-side from a downsampled amplitude envelope; original audio never reaches the browser during review. Preview tiles are cached for 24 hours and carry no metadata beyond track duration. Access to the preview signing key is gated behind the sealed reviewer vault, which opens only with the recovery passphrase noted below.

unlock words, yawig-kagef: gordor-holvan-ulaael-pramir-ulaiel-tamdor

Welcome to the Crumbwell ordering service! One quirk you'll inherit: the bakery cutoff rule. Orders for next-day pickup close at 16:00 bakery-local time, full stop — the ovens at Millbrook Lane get loaded that evening, so late orders silently roll to the following day. The cutoff lives in the scheduler config, not the UI, so change it in one place only. Deploys to the scheduler go through our signed pipeline, and releases are verified against the key below.

deploy key for kajof-fajop: bky6_gDHw9Q

## Authentication

TimeForge, our school timetable solver, exposes its scheduling API behind the Corvid auth gateway. All solver requests must carry a bearer token scoped to the `timetable:solve` permission; read-only lookups of published timetables use the lighter `timetable:read` scope. Tokens expire after twelve hours, and the gateway rejects clock-skewed requests beyond ninety seconds, so keep your machines synced. For this week's eng sync demo environment, we provisioned a shared service credential, which you'll find directly below.

gateway credential: kto23_LX9A4ys6i4nzHtpOLNLodKK

### Key Ceremony Checklist — Item 7 (Lunaria Payments)

Before you rotate the signing key, make sure the flaky integration suite for checkout retries is quarantined — otherwise the ceremony pipeline will red-flag the rollout for no good reason. Tag the skipped tests, ping the Brindlewood channel, and grab the ceremony kit. The restore step will ask for the passphrase printed below.

unlock words, fafop-hawep: briwyn-oliix-sorox